Key bonus terms you should know

  • Wagering requirement – the number of times you must bet the bonus before cashing out.
  • Maximum cash‑out – the highest amount you can withdraw from winnings generated by the bonus.
  • Game contribution – slots usually count 100 % while table games may count only 10 %.
  • Expiry – most bonuses must be used within 7 days of activation.

6. Security, Licensing and Responsible Gambling

Security is a top priority at Orionbets UK. All data is encrypted using 128‑bit SSL, the same standard used by banks. The site holds a licence from the UK Gambling Commission, which guarantees that games are regularly audited for fairness and that player funds are kept in a segregated account. This means your money cannot be used for operational costs or withdrawn by the operator.

Responsible gambling tools are built directly into the user dashboard. You can set daily, weekly or monthly deposit limits, self‑exclude for a chosen period, or request a “cool‑off” session if you feel you need a break. The platform also provides links to UK‑based support charities such as GamCare and GambleAware, ensuring help is always a click away.
